StandardAero Component Services announced a significant investment and expansion at three of its U.S. sites during 2018. The company will invest approximately $16 million to increase shop capacity by 260,000 square feet collectively at facilities in Cincinnati and Hillsboro, Ohio, and Miami, Fla. The Miami site will add 30,000 square feet of working space and install an additional vacuum furnace, a state-of-the-art clean line and add water-jet cleaning capabilities. As a result, the facility will be able to repair large engine cases.
Cincinnati will build out an additional 200,000 square feet of work space to accommodate military and commercial engine component repair. Hillsboro will complete a 30,000-square-foot expansion to support new OEM manufacturing production, bringing the facility’s total manufacturing footprint to 115,000 square feet.
According to StandardAero Component Services, the expanded capabilities also include dedicated processes for the repair, overhaul and manufacturing of various component types to support customers’ engine needs.
